Working with our partners at ISS Market Intelligence, Worth’s editorial staff has evaluated more than 41,000 RIAs and financial advisors operating in the United States and identified the top 300 firms.

Leading Advisor RIA Criteria

The core value of the Leading Advisor program to our readers lies in its rigorous selection process and the credibility it bestows upon each listed advisor. Each firm featured has successfully cleared stringent benchmarks:

  • AUM of Over $500 Million: Demonstrates substantial experience and trust in handling significant wealth.
  • Predominantly High-Net-Worth Clients: Shows specialized expertise in managing the complex financial situations typical of wealthier clients.
  • Substantial Planning Clientele: Indicates a focus on comprehensive financial planning rather than simple asset management.
  • Independence from Broker-Dealers: Ensures advice is unbiased and purely client-centric.

These criteria spotlight firms that manage wealth and craft tailored strategies that consider the broader financial picture. Thus, they enhance our readers’ ability to make informed choices about who manages their wealth.

Data for our evaluation come from the N-PX disclosure forms these companies are required to file with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The public can review SEC filings through the commission’s online database, EDGAR.
